I have an old Craftsman push mower, Model is 917.377130, 6hp. It has 9 inch wheels and one has broken. I'm having a hard time finding a 9 inch wheel without spending a fortune. I can get two 8 inch wheels with metal supports for $10 each. Can I put these smaller wheels on the back without problem? The mower has self propelled, but its front wheel drive. Well you will be 1/2" lower at the back which will cause the blade to heel so each blade of grass will get cut twice once by the front and again a the back 1/2" lower
Note this effect gets less as you go left right
Some times this can cause a problem with catching & throwing
OTOH if you can space the rear wheels 1/2" higher then you are on a winner
